  Behind the appearance of girls in Hanfu on the stage of the Spring Festival Gala is good news for the modern spread of Chinese culture. The "2023 Chinese Brand Development Trend Report" shows that from 2019 to 2022, the number of Chinese consumers purchasing domestic products and trend-related products increased by 74%, and the transaction value increased by 355%. At the just-concluded 2024 Autumn and Winter MODE Shanghai Clothing and Accessories Exhibition, brands related to national style and trend accounted for 25% of the independent participating brands this season.

  Nowadays, new Chinese-style clothing that is both beautiful and practical has occupied a place in the wardrobes of more and more consumers. During the Spring Festival, topics such as "Caoxian sold 300 million horse-faced skirts but still in short supply" became hot searches, and the transaction volume of the Hanfu category on an e-commerce platform increased by 325% year-on-year. The topic "New Chinese Style Outfits" has received hundreds of millions of views on social platforms, and there have been more than 3 million related notes.

  “Only national products are international products” seems to be the consensus in the fashion industry. However, Wu Haiyan, vice chairman of the China Fashion Designers Association and professor at the China Academy of Art, believes that Chinese fashion designers appear on the international stage not to satisfy Western society’s curiosity about mysterious oriental art, but to use their unique insights in the context of globalization. Form a unique "one yuan" and promote the diverse interaction of world cultures.

  Based on her own experience, Wu Haiyan believes that Chinese designers must have two abilities. One is the ability to use international popular language to express the nation's unique aesthetic taste, and the other is the ability to use traditional national elements to demonstrate common international aesthetic trends. "China has a splendid and long-standing clothing culture, and it should also have a say in the international fashion industry. This requires Chinese designers to continue to create persuasive works and rely on 'action' to gain 'status.'"

  She said that Shanghai, as China's fashion highland, should first establish and improve a sustainable fashion ecosystem, including financial capital, news media, university talents, industrial processing, designer talents, fashion life, etc.
